description |
Carthamus tinctorius (kasumba turate) is medical plant which is widely used as
traditional medicine as anti-inflammatory. As an anti-inflammatory, NSAIDs are
usually used, but they have various side effects on the gastrointestinal tract and
kidneys. In this study, a re-production of the nanoemulsion formulation contain
ethanolic extract of Kesumba flower was carried out. In addition, nanosuspension
formula was also produced and evaluated. In vitro studies of anti-inflammatory
activity were carried out by testing the ability of formulation to inhibit albumin
denaturation. In vivo anti-inflammatory activity was also carried out on male
wistar rats through an acute inflammation and induced by ?-carrageenan. The
results of particle size, polydispersity index, and zeta potential on the nanoemulsion
formula were 96.5±8.98 nm; 0.371±0.03; and -3.3±0.26 mV respectively.
Meanwhile, in the nanosuspension formula, the particle size, polydispersity index,
zeta potential were 296.7±8.62 nm; 0.351±0.021; and -40.6 mV respectively. The
IC50 values in the albumin denaturation inhibition activity test on nanosuspensions
and nanoemulsions were 218.75±27.72 ?g/mL and 237.47±41.12 ?g/mL. In
addition, the inhibition of extract in concentration of 1600 ?g/mL was
34,51±3,31%. The results of the in vivo anti-inflammatory activity test showed that
the nanosuspension formula at a dose of 100 mg/kgbw is better to suppress
inflammation than extract.
